This is another uncommon penetration twinned crystal from Illinois. It is lustrous and very slightly translucent with a vibrant, deep purple color. Gemmy colorless calcite crystals preferentially cover certain faces of the fluorite crystals which reach 4 cm across. Mined in July 1993 from the northern extension of the Bahama ore body. Ex. Ross Lillie collection RCL# 0462. Unusually dramatic!
